Hungarian researchers have developed an artificial intelligence-based camera system capable of continuously monitoring the body position and movement of premature infants in an incubator without the use of wires or physical sensors, the HUN-REN Hungarian Research Network told MTI on Friday.

The results of this internationally outstanding development—a collaboration between HUN-REN SZTAKI – Institute for Computer Science and Control and Semmelweis University—were published in the prestigious journal Pediatric Research.

They explained that

monitoring the movement and sleeping positions of babies in neonatal intensive care units is crucial for assessing the development of the nervous system and for the early detection of neurological abnormalities.

The smart camera system they developed analyzes videos of newborns in incubators in real time with centimeter-level precision and can distinguish between normal movements and reactions indicating stress or abnormalities. Furthermore, the solution helps align examinations and care with the infants’ natural sleep-wake cycles, which has been shown to accelerate their development and shorten their hospital stays, the announcement added.

The technology is powered by sophisticated deep-learning algorithms that have been trained on a large dataset.

To develop it, the researchers analyzed a total of about 8,400 hours of video footage of 88 premature infants.

The new method offers several medical advantages. Since it operates completely wirelessly and without physical contact, it protects newborns from skin irritation and restricted movement caused by physical sensors. The continuous 24/7 monitoring also provides a far more precise picture than periodic clinical rounds. This allows examinations and daily care to be tailored to the babies’ natural sleep-wake cycles. This reduction in stress and the personalized care have been shown to accelerate the development of the most vulnerable patients and can thus significantly shorten their hospital stay.
